Overview of the role of doctors in healthcare & medicine
Doctors play a crucial role in the healthcare industry by diagnosing, treating and preventing illnesses and injuries. They are responsible for the overall health and wellbeing of their patients by providing medical care, advice and support. They work in hospitals, clinics and private practices, and are often the first point of contact for patients seeking medical attention.
Types of doctors and their specialties
There are various types of doctors, each with their own specialty. General practitioners (GPs) provide primary care and treat a wide range of medical conditions. Other specialists include pediatricians, gynecologists, dermatologists, cardiologists, neurologists, oncologists and psychiatrists, to name a few. These specialists focus on specific areas of medicine and provide in-depth knowledge and expertise in their field.
Education and training required to become a doctor
Becoming a doctor requires extensive education and training. A medical degree from a recognized university is a minimum requirement, and after that, doctors must complete a residency program that typically lasts for 3-7 years, depending on the specialty. They must also obtain a license to practice medicine, which requires passing a competency exam. Continuing education is also necessary to stay up-to-date with the latest medical knowledge and advancements.
Importance of regular check-ups and preventative care
Regular check-ups and preventative care are important for maintaining good health and preventing illnesses. Doctors can detect potential health issues early on and provide treatment before they become serious. They also provide advice on healthy lifestyle choices, such as diet and exercise, and can help manage chronic conditions.
Common medical conditions and illnesses treated by doctors
Doctors treat a wide range of medical conditions and illnesses, from minor injuries to chronic diseases. Some of the most common medical conditions include colds and flu, allergies, asthma, diabetes, hypertension, heart disease, arthritis and cancer. Doctors work to diagnose and treat these conditions using a variety of tools and treatments.
Diagnostic tools and procedures used by doctors
Doctors use various diagnostic tools and procedures to identify medical conditions and develop treatment plans. Some common tools include blood tests, X-rays, CT scans, MRIs and ultrasounds. Doctors may also perform physical exams and ask patients about their symptoms to make a diagnosis.
Treatment options available to patients
There are various treatment options available to patients, depending on their condition. Treatments may include medication, surgery, physical therapy, lifestyle modifications and alternative therapies. Doctors work with patients to develop a personalized treatment plan that addresses their unique needs and preferences.
Importance of communication and trust between doctors and patients
Effective communication and trust between doctors and patients is crucial for providing quality healthcare. When patients feel comfortable sharing their concerns and symptoms with their doctors, they are more likely to receive an accurate diagnosis and effective treatment. Doctors who listen actively and provide clear explanations help build trust with their patients.
Insurance and payment options for medical services
Medical services can be expensive, but there are insurance and payment options available to help manage the costs. In the UK, most medical services are provided by the National Health Service (NHS), which is free at the point of care. Private health insurance is also available for those who wish to access private medical services. Patients may also be able to pay for services out-of-pocket or through financing options.
